摘要
Within the Russian Science Foundation (RSF) project 21-79-10051 we developed a mobile lidar system for monitoring of tropospheric ozone and aerosol at the sensing wavelengths 299/341 nm. The lidar system is created on the basis of the QX 500 laser ("SOLAR LS", Belarus) and Cassegrain telescope with receiving mirror diameter of 0.35 m and focal length of 0.7 m. Balancing and commissioning of laser source are carried out. Tests of receiving-transmitting lidar channel showed that the mobile lidar can cover the altitude range from ~0.1 to 12 km.
